Many moons ago, when I worked for the college paper, I made it a point to come up with a great deal of ideas. Unfortunately, I never had the gumption to implement a lot of them.

There was one in particular that I still cling to in the hopes that, one day, it will take hold and skyrocket me to the pinnacle of journalistic creativity.

"Pick Pockets" was going to be a weekly column where a street correspondent with interview random people on the street about the contents of their pockets (a highly underrated method of storage), and have them muse about its contents.

For example, my pockets contain:

- an iPhone w/earbuds
- exactly $0.36 in change
- a monogrammed money clip with various cards and $18 in cash
- a half-used stick of lip balm

Right off the bat I can tell you that I'm relatively broke. This is one of the first times (in a very long time) that I've had a little bit of extra money in my pockets. Surprisingly enough, I am one of the few guys I know who doesn't keep his cell phone on some ridiculous belt clip. Other than that, I really like my money clip (had it for three years or so). It was a gift from my girlfriend.
-----------
You see the potential of a piece like this? The possibilities? From just a few contents in one's pockets you have the potential to create an entire profile story. I will try my hardest to incorporate this idea into future posts and see what I can come up with. I will keep you all posted.
